A previously reported cDNA clone [pP450(1)] coding for a phenobarbital-inducible cytochrome P-450 variant of rat liver microsomal membranes, designated P-450e(U.C.), was used as a specific hybridization probe to screen a human liver cDNA library. Restriction mapping showed that two of the colonies isolated contained plasmids coding for overlapping regions of the same cDNA sequence. The clone [pHP450(1)] having the longer cDNA insert (1.25 kilobase pairs) was sequenced. The homology between the rat and human cDNAs is 62% in their coding regions but is only random (24%) in the 3'-noncoding nucleotides. The amino acid sequence deduced from the human cDNA is 50% identical to that of P-450e(U.C.). The homology increases to 72% if conservative changes in amino acid residues are permitted. The hydropathy profile of the polypeptide encoded by pHP450(1) is almost identical to that of P-450e(U.C.). Regions known to be highly conserved in cytochrome P-450 isozymes isolated from rat, rabbit, and mouse were found to be conserved in the amino acid sequence derived from pHP450(1). Analysis by Southern blotting indicated that the human cytochrome P-450 encoded by pHP450(1) is part of a multigene family.
